2.5 Safety
The unit complies with "class I equipment" in which protection against electric shocks relies on accessible
conductive parts that are connected to the protective earthing-conductor in the fixed wiring of the
installation, in such a way that they can not become live in the event of a failure of the basic insulation.
If the controller is not earthed and the controller relays are used to switch circuits with voltage
!
of 42.4V peak and more, electrocution of people could happen.
If one of the circuits connected with the controller have voltages of 42.2V peak or more, the unit is classified
as "class III equipment". Although in this situation safety earth is not needed, it is still necessary to earth the
unit to fulfil the electromagnetic compatibility demands.
The housings on both controllers must be earthed at all times using 6mm terminals.
CompAir disclaims any warranty in a case an unauthorized person has opened the module.
2.6 Power supply
The power supply connector is indicated on the back cover with X03.
The controller requires a 2 off 24VAC / 25VA power supplies.
Important note:
DO NOT GROUND THE 24VAC SECONDARY WINDINGS OF THE TRANSFORMERS.
DOING SO WILL CAUSE SEVERE DAMAGE !!! THE 24VAC SECONDARY WINDING
!
DOES NOT NEED TO BE GROUNDED (See EN 60420-1 Safety of machinery part 1
general requirements – IEC 204-1:1992 modified.)
To make sure both the two-pins power supply connector X03 and the two-pins communication
connector X06 cannot be interchanged. The supply cable connector must be equipped with two
polarization keys as shown below. + ve to Pin 1
The interchanging of the supply and communication connectors will severely damage the
unit. Therefore the use of polarization keys is compulsory
